A City's Air Quality
Delving deeper into the complexities of urban pollution, we'll examine how air quality significantly varies among the affected cities. The concentration of particulate matter (PM2.5 and PM10), nitrogen dioxide (NO2), and ground-level ozone (O3) often determine the air quality index (AQI). High levels of PM2.5, for instance, which are fine inhalable particles, are closely associated with respiratory ailments and cardiovascular diseases. NO2, primarily originating from vehicle exhaust, can irritate the lungs and contribute to smog formation. Ground-level ozone, formed by the reaction of pollutants in sunlight, can damage lung tissue. These pollutants don't just affect human health; they also contribute to acid rain, damage to ecosystems, and the acceleration of climate change. Each city faces unique challenges depending on its geography, industry, and population density, leading to distinctive pollution profiles. Further, the combination of these factors significantly contributes to the cities' ranking on global pollution indices. Health Risks Multiply
The detrimental impact of pollution on public health is substantial and far-reaching. Exposure to polluted air can cause a wide spectrum of health problems, from mild to severe. Short-term exposure to pollutants can lead to coughing, sneezing, and eye irritation. Long-term exposure, however, increases the risk of chronic conditions, such as asthma, bronchitis, and lung cancer. Cardiovascular diseases, including heart attacks and strokes, are often exacerbated by air pollution. Furthermore, the most vulnerable populations, such as children, the elderly, and those with pre-existing conditions, are at the highest risk. Pollution's effect is not limited to physical health. Studies suggest that air pollution can also affect mental health, increasing stress and anxiety levels. Governments and healthcare systems in highly polluted cities face increased costs as they tackle a rise in pollution-related illnesses, placing a strain on resources and potentially reducing the quality of care available.
Sources of Contamination
Identifying the root causes of pollution is essential for effective mitigation. The primary sources of air pollution vary by city, but commonly include industrial emissions, vehicular traffic, and the burning of fossil fuels for energy. Industrial plants often release a mix of pollutants, including heavy metals, particulate matter, and harmful gases, into the atmosphere. The volume of vehicles on roads contributes significantly to emissions of NO2, carbon monoxide, and particulate matter. The energy sector, reliant on coal, oil, and natural gas, is a major contributor to greenhouse gas emissions, increasing air pollution. Additionally, agricultural practices, such as the use of fertilizers and pesticides, can lead to water and soil pollution. Urbanization, population growth, and inadequate waste management further contribute to environmental degradation.
